Use complete sentences to explain how the mass of hydrogen is conserved during cellular respiration.

The mass of hydrogen is conserved during cellular respiration as it follows the Law of Conservation of Matter. This shows that hydrogen has been conserved throughout the entire process (H representing Hydrogen) as the product has the same amount of hydrogen as the reactants.
